arg1, arg2, arg3 − These are the arguments passed to the function. In this program, two buttons are present. Normally, we do this with setTimeout().. For repeatedly calling some function every X milliseconds, one would … How to call a jQuery function after a certain delay? I have two javascript functions that are called from android. } Let us see an example. In Javascript, setTimeoutis a function that executes a method after a specified amount of time in milliseconds. } Tip: Use the clearTimeout() method to prevent the function from running. JavaScript can initiate an action or repeat it after a specified interval. Syntax: $(selector).delay(para1, para2); Parameter: It accepts two parameters which are specified below- para1: It specifies the speed of the delay. You can see, here I have used setTimeout function to achieve the delay. This is the main function to play audio after 8 seconds. THE CERTIFICATION NAMES ARE THE TRADEMARKS OF THEIR RESPECTIVE OWNERS. In this program, a button “Click me” is created which calls the function func1() on clicking the button. Therefore we can generate this behavior ourselves using a small helper function, thanks to the asynchronous nature of javascript. On executing the code, it can be seen that a button with a certain text gets displayed. Let us see some sample programs on the setTimeout function. You can change the delay time, feedback, and mix levels on the fly. setTimeout is a native JavaScript function (although it can be used with a library such as jQuery, as we’ll see later on), which calls a function or executes a … The event loop checks whether or not JavaScript is ready to receive the results from the queued work.

Please click the button "Click me" and see what happens after 3 seconds.

The setTimeout() method calls a function or evaluates an expression after a specified number of milliseconds. The delay() is an inbuilt method in jQuery which is used to set a timer to delay the execution of the next item in the queue. . setTimeout(function(){ v.value="4 secs" }, 4000); In this tutorial, we'll learn how to create a debounce function in JavaScript. After all, setTimeout() is not actually a … para2: It is optional and specifies the name of the queue. The function delay(ms) should return a promise. JavaScript is a (browser side) client side scripting language where we could implement client side validation and other features. Looking back at the docs, you realize that the problem is that the first argument is actually supposed to be a function call, not the delay. What is debounce?The term javascript set delay . .

milliseconds − The number of milliseconds. Source: In PHP there is a function sleep() to delay execution of the PHP script, but JavaScript doesn't have such a function. Example: The function will be executed after 5 seconds (5000 milliseconds). Let's write a wait function: ");